首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我无法使用npm运行部署部署react应用程序

npm是Node.js的包管理器,用于安装、管理和发布JavaScript模块。在使用npm运行部署React应用程序时,您可以按照以下步骤进行操作:

  1. 确保您已经安装了Node.js和npm。您可以在命令行中运行以下命令来检查它们的版本:
  2. 确保您已经安装了Node.js和npm。您可以在命令行中运行以下命令来检查它们的版本:
  3. 在命令行中,进入您的React应用程序的根目录。
  4. 确保您的应用程序的根目录中包含一个有效的package.json文件。如果没有,您可以通过运行以下命令来创建一个新的package.json文件:
  5. 确保您的应用程序的根目录中包含一个有效的package.json文件。如果没有,您可以通过运行以下命令来创建一个新的package.json文件:
  6. 确保您的React应用程序的依赖项在package.json文件中正确地列出。如果您需要安装React和其他依赖项,可以使用以下命令:
  7. 确保您的React应用程序的依赖项在package.json文件中正确地列出。如果您需要安装React和其他依赖项,可以使用以下命令:
  8. package.json文件中,您可以定义一个脚本来运行部署React应用程序的命令。例如,您可以在scripts部分添加以下内容:
  9. package.json文件中,您可以定义一个脚本来运行部署React应用程序的命令。例如,您可以在scripts部分添加以下内容:
  10. 在上面的代码中,start命令用于在开发模式下运行应用程序,build命令用于构建生产版本的应用程序,deploy命令用于运行构建命令并执行部署操作。您需要将<deploy-command>替换为实际的部署命令,具体取决于您使用的部署工具或平台。
  11. 保存package.json文件后,您可以在命令行中运行以下命令来部署React应用程序:
  12. 保存package.json文件后,您可以在命令行中运行以下命令来部署React应用程序:
  13. 这将触发deploy脚本,并根据您在package.json文件中定义的命令来构建和部署应用程序。

请注意,上述步骤中的<deploy-command>是一个占位符,您需要根据您的实际情况替换为适当的部署命令。另外,腾讯云提供了一系列与云计算相关的产品和服务,您可以根据您的需求选择适合的产品进行部署。具体的产品介绍和链接地址可以在腾讯云官方网站上找到。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在Linode上部署React应用程序

由于基本的React应用程序是静态的(它由已编译的HTML,CSS和JavaScript文件组成),因此使用Rsync可以轻松地从本地计算机部署到Linode 。...4.本指南假设你已经拥有了要部署React应用程序。如果你没有,可以使用create-react-app快速生成应用程序。...例如: cd ~/myapp 如果你没有可以使用的现有项目,可以使用create-react-app创建一个。 2.使用文本编辑器,在你的应用程序根目录中创建一个名为deploy的部署脚本。...如果部署成功,你将看到你的React应用程序。 6.对应用程序的src目录进行一些更改,然后重新运行deploy脚本。重新加载页面后,您的更改应在浏览器中可见。...虽然提供这些是希望它们有用,但请注意,我们无法保证这些资源的准确性或及时性。 React - 用于构建用户界面的JavaScript库 使用NGINX部署使用Sass的React应用程序

2.7K40
  • 使用dotCloud在云端部署Django应用程序

    文档 在开始使用任何新服务之前,通常会做的第一件事就是查看文档。DotCloud有一个很好的文档列表以及一些关于如何开始的教程。这4个文件是使用最多的文件。...有默认模板的问题,需要添加一个目录到sys.path,以便wsgi可以正确地找到我的django应用程序。这是完成的文件。...因此,替代这个的服务是一个不能完全支持SASL的服务,而不是部署一个不安全的服务。有一些方法可以使用memcached,但它涉及到各种复杂的防火墙规则,并运行诸如stunnel之类的东西。...部署 现在我们准备部署我们的Django应用程序,但是在进一步了解之前,了解以下内容很重要。Dotcloud会关注你的.gitignore文件。...使用正常的非PaaS设置,缩放应用程序可能会非常痛苦和耗时,但使用PaaS可以像运行一些命令一样简单。有三种缩放类型,垂直,水平,高可用性。 纵向扩展,意味着增加现在的服务,使其可以变得更大。

    3.3K70

    使用dotCloud在云端部署Django应用程序

    如果应用程序前端使用Django或Rails,而在后端使用Java,也是可以的。大多数开发人员不会在开发所有应用中使用同一个技术栈,所以这可以让你灵活地使用最好的工具来完成这项工作。...将详细介绍将我的博客安装到dotCloud上的步骤,希望能够回答一些常见的问题。 文档 在开始使用任何新服务之前,通常会做的第一件事就是查看文档。...这4个文档是使用最多的。...因此,dotCloud决定不完全支持memcached,而不是部署一个不安全的服务。有一些方法可以强行使用memcached,但它涉及到各种复杂的防火墙规则,并运行诸如stunnel之类的东西。...部署 现在我们准备部署Django应用程序,但是首先要注意,dotcloud会读取.gitignore文件,如果在.gitignore文件中,忽略了某个设置文件,这个设置文件就不会被保存到仓库,不会把更改推送到云端

    3.6K110

    如何使用Shiny Server部署R应用程序

    将Shiny应用程序部署到Web上的方法有很多种; 本教程使用Shiny Server在Linode上托管示例Shiny应用程序。...没有服务器的同学可以在这里购买,不过个人更推荐您使用免费的腾讯云开发者实验室进行试验,学会安装后在购买服务器。 您还需要在您的本地计算机安装RStudio,如何安装请参考RStudio官方文档。...例如,要使用黑色边框将条形更改为红色: hist(x, breaks = bins, col = 'red', border = 'black') 要在本地测试项目,请单击文本编辑器右上角的“ 运行应用程序...请考虑使用更复杂的部署方法,例如Git或Rsync。...生产部署还可能希望在反向代理后面运行Shiny Server以利用其他安全性和优化功能。怎么样,学会了吗?快尝试购买一台服务器进行测试吧!更多Linux教程请前往腾讯云+社区学习更多知识。

    6.2K50

    使用dotCloud在云端部署Django应用程序

    这4个文件是使用最多的文件。...需要对默认模板做出调整,需要添加一个目录到sys.path,以便wsgi可以正确地找到我的django应用程序。这是完成的文件。...因此,dotCloud决定不完全支持它,而不是部署一个不安全的服务。有一些方法可以使用它,但它涉及到各种复杂的防火墙规则,并需要运行诸如stunnel之类的东西。所以这是可能的,但不是很好用和安全。...部署 现在我们准备部署我们的Django应用程序,但是在进一步了解之前,了解以下内容很重要。Dotcloud会关注你的.gitignore文件。...使用正常的非PaaS设置,伸缩应用程序可能会非常痛苦和耗时,但使用PaaS可以像运行一些命令一样简单。有三种缩放类型,垂直,水平,以及高可用性。 纵向扩展,意味着增加现在的服务,使其规模变得更大。

    4.1K100

    使用github-action推送博客部署仓库至NPM

    更新记录 2022-01-17:教程起草 编写参考教程 解决.github无法通过hexo deploy推送的问题 弃用新增npm插件的方案。...改为直接使用本地新建scripts 绘制流程图 参考方向 教程原贴 参考了小康的博文中,关于解决hexo deploy无法提交.github文件夹至博客部署仓库的办法。...推荐阅读前置教程 因为传统的hexo deploy无法将.github文件夹也一并提交至部署仓库,所以需要用git提交流程来完成站点内容部署。...无法推送public文件夹中的.github文件夹至博客部署仓库username.github.io,所以此处需要我们手动提交。...image.png image.png image.png 因为直接使用 hexo deploy 无法推送public文件夹中的.github文件夹至博客部署仓库username.github.io,所有此处我们需要更改

    52610

    浅谈vscode+react环境部署运行第一个react框架

    文章目录 前言 一、安装vscode 二、安装node、npm、yarn(采用淘宝镜像) 1.安装node 2.安装yarn 三、拉取React脚手架,运行第一个项目 总结 前言 react官网 https...://react.docschina.org/docs/getting-started.html 运行结果图: ---- 一、安装vscode 见链接:https://www.cnblogs.com/...二、安装node、npm、yarn(采用淘宝镜像) 1.安装node 见链接:https://blog.csdn.net/bbj12345678/article/details/106741758 检测是否已经安装...脚手架,运行第一个项目 官网教程: 在vscode终端里面运行下面的语句: npx create-react-app my-app cd my-app npm start 视频教程:https:/.../www.bilibili.com/video/BV1CK4y1p7fb/ 等待加载完毕,我们再输入 yarn run start 运行即可。

    1.4K20

    使用 LeanCloud 云引擎部署 React Web 应用

    npx create-react-app react-for-engine --use-npm 之后将创建好的项目上传 Github 仓库中,后面来配置 Github action 自动部署脚本以及 Leancloud...install http-proxy-middleware --save 如果无需处理跨域请求,直接使用 npm run start 即可运行的话则无需使用该脚本。...需要注意的是其中监听端口需要使用 leancloud 提供的环境变量 LEANCLOUD_APP_PORT 指定的端口,如果用错了则无法正常访问服务。...如果直接使用 npm run start 启动的话则需修改 package.json 中 start 部分的声明: "start":"set PORT=$LEANCLOUD_APP_PORT && react-scripts...总结# 至此,简单的 Leancloud 部署 react 单页应用的方法介绍完毕,由于 Leancloud 是一个 BaaS 平台,可直接当作简单后端和数据存储服务器来使用,做开发测试使用很好,等后期有流量了再升级付费套餐即可获取更好的服务体验

    24420

    使用Zookeeper分布式部署PHP应用程序

    Zookper很容易编程接入,它使用了一个和文件树结构相似的数据模型。 虽然ZooKeeper是一个Java应用程序,但C也可以使用。...$ vim /etc/php5/cli/conf.d/20-zookeeper.ini 因为不需要运行在web服务环境下,所以这里只编辑了CLI的配置。将下面的行复制到ini文件中。...extension=zookeeper.so 使用如下命令来确定扩展是否已起作用。 $ php -m | grep zookeeper zookeeper 现在是时候运行ZooKeeper了。...现在你可以准备创建分布式应用程序了。其中的挑战是让这些独立的程序决定哪个(是leader)协调它们的工作,以及哪些(是worker)需要执行。...在真实的应用程序中,leader会给worker分配任务、监控进程和保存结果。这里为了简化,跳过了这些部分。 创建一个新的PHP文件,命名为worker.php。 <?

    83331

    Spark2.3.0 使用spark-submit部署应用程序

    可以通过一个统一的接口使用 Spark 所有支持的集群管理器,因此不必为每个集群管理器专门配置你的应用程序。 2....使用spark-submit启动应用程序 用户应用程序打包成功后,就可以使用 bin/spark-submit 脚本启动应用程序。...local[K] 使用K个工作线程本地运行 Spark(理想情况下,设置这个值的数量为你机器内核数量)。...local[K,F] 使用K工作线程和F个 maxFailures 在本地运行 Spark(有关此变量的解释,请参阅spark.task.maxFailures) local[*] 使用与你机器上的逻辑内核一样多的工作线程在本地运行...如果不清楚配置选项来自哪里,可以通过使用 --verbose 选项运行 spark-submit 打印出细粒度的调试信息。 7.

    3K40

    开发|使用war包部署在Tomcat中运行

    Tomcat 服务器是一个免费的开放源代码的Web 应用服务器,属于轻量级应用服务器,在中小型系统和并发访问用户不是很多的场合下被普遍使用,是开发和调试JSP 程序的首选。...实际Tomcat是Apache 服务器的扩展,但运行时它是独立运行的,所以当我们运行Tomcat时,它实际上作为一个与Apache 独立的进程单独运行的。...然后把准备好的war包复制粘贴到webapps目录,返回上一级目录,找到bin,打开bin文件,在bin里面找到starup运行tomcat。运行成功如图所示。 ?...紧接着我们去打开浏览器,输入我们的地址 localhost:你的端口号/你的项目名称,你要运行的jsp文件,下面就是运行结果。 ?

    2.4K10

    使用Kubernetes和Ambassador API Gateway部署Java应用程序

    使用Kubernetes和Ambassador API Gateway部署Java应用程序 在本文中,您将学习如何将三个简单的Java服务部署到Kubernetes(通过新的Docker for Mac...还向您展示了如何通过使用NodePort服务映射和公开Kubernetes集群端口来向最终用户打开店面服务。虽然这对于演示来说很有用,但是很多人问你如何在API网关后面部署应用程序。...图1.使用Ambassador API Gateway部署的“Docker Java Shopping”应用程序 快速旁白:为什么使用API网关?...因为喜欢每隔一段时间拥抱一次的内心时髦,使用Docker for Mac中的新Kubernetes集成来运行此演示。...我们无法在集群外部访问此端口(就像我们可以使用NodePort),但在集群内,一切都按预期工作。

    3.2K20

    如何在Ubuntu上使用Webhooks和Slack部署React

    在本教程中,您将使用create-react-app npm包构建React应用程序。该软件包通过转换语法和简化依赖项和必备工具的工作,简化了引导React项目的工作。...没有服务器的同学可以在这里购买,不过个人更推荐您使用免费的腾讯云开发者实验室进行试验,学会安装后在购买服务器。 参照本文第一部分,安装Nginx。...请参考Slack官方文档 第一步 - 使用create-react-app创建React应用程序 让我们首先用create-react-app构建我们将用于测试webhooks的应用程序。...它运行一个为服务器提供服务的HTTP服务器。 build:此脚本负责制作应用程序的生产版本。您将在服务器上使用此脚本。 test:此脚本运行与项目关联的默认测试。...结论 我们现在已经使用webhooks,Nginx,shell脚本和Slack完成了部署系统的设置。你现在应该能够: 配置Nginx以使用应用程序的动态构建。

    8.7K20
    领券